Простой и понятный способ создания DFD-диаграммы из IDEF0 для более эффективного проектирования бизнес-процессов

IDEF0 (Integrating Domain-Based Extended Functionality) — это методология, используемая для моделирования бизнес-процессов. С помощью IDEF0 можно создать диаграмму потоков данных (DFD), которая визуализирует потоки данных и функций, выполняемых внутри системы или организации. Этот инструмент позволяет описать бизнес-процесс в понятной форме и увидеть его структуру и взаимосвязи.

Создание DFD-диаграммы из IDEF0 можно разделить на несколько шагов. Во-первых, следует определить цель моделирования и выбрать систему или организацию, которую вы хотите изучить. Во-вторых, проведите анализ бизнес-процессов и определите основные функции, выполняемые в системе. Определите входы и выходы каждой функции, а также потоки данных между ними. В-третьих, постройте диаграмму потоков данных, используя символы и нотации IDEF0.

Для построения DFD-диаграммы из IDEF0 можно использовать специализированный программный инструмент, или нарисовать ее вручную на бумаге или с помощью графического редактора. Важно соблюдать правила нотации IDEF0, чтобы диаграмма была понятна и информативна.

Разделительно-иерархическая диаграмма функций (DFD) и Метод IDEF0

Разделительно-иерархическая диаграмма функций (DFD) представляет собой метод моделирования бизнес-процессов и систем, который был разработан в рамках метода IDEF0 (Integration DEFinition for Function Modeling).

Метод IDEF0 разработан с целью создания стандартного набора правил и символов для анализа и проектирования бизнес-процессов. Он является частью более общей системы моделирования IDEF, которая включает в себя несколько вариантов моделей и методов. IDEF0 часто используется при проектировании информационных систем и бизнес-процессов.

DFD представляет собой графическое представление бизнес-процесса или системы, которое позволяет декомпозировать его на функциональные блоки и установить связи между ними. Главная цель DFD — изучение потоков данных, поэтому каждый блок представляет собой функцию, а стрелки — потоки данных между функциональными блоками.

Метод IDEF0 предлагает стандартные символы и правила для построения DFD-диаграмм. Основными символами являются функциональные блоки и стрелки, которые образуют древовидную иерархию блоков разных уровней. Функциональные блоки описывают выполняемую функцию, а стрелки показывают поток данных между функциональными блоками.

DFD-диаграмма успешно применяется в таких областях, как инженерия, информационные системы, производство и т.д. Она позволяет легко визуализировать и анализировать бизнес-процессы и системы, а также их взаимосвязи. Кроме того, DFD-диаграмма может использоваться для определения задач и ролей в рамках проекта, что позволяет более эффективно планировать и управлять процессами.

Создание DFD-диаграммы из IDEF0 метода требует четкого понимания бизнес-процессов и ее целей. Необходимо определить функциональные блоки и потоки данных, а затем логически организовать их на диаграмме. В результате получается наглядное представление бизнес-процесса, которое помогает лучше понять его структуру и оптимизировать его работу.

Что такое DFD-диаграмма?

DFD-диаграмма (Data Flow Diagram) представляет собой визуальное представление процесса или системы, которое показывает, как данные перемещаются и обрабатываются внутри системы. Она широко используется в области системного анализа и проектирования программного обеспечения.

DFD-диаграмма состоит из различных блоков и стрелок. Блоки представляют собой процессы, внешние сущности или потоки данных. Стрелки указывают направление перемещения данных. Данная диаграмма помогает описать взаимосвязи между процессами и данными, а также их взаимодействие с внешними сущностями.

DFD-диаграмма может быть использована для анализа текущей системы или для проектирования новой системы. Она помогает увидеть, какие данные требуются на входе и выходе из каждого процесса, а также какие процессы взаимодействуют друг с другом. Это позволяет выявить потенциальные проблемы в процессе обработки данных и определить оптимальные способы их решения.

DFD-диаграмма является наглядным инструментом для коммуникации между разработчиками и заказчиками. Она помогает уточнить требования к системе и получить согласие на предлагаемое решение. Кроме того, DFD-диаграмма является основой для дальнейшего проектирования и разработки системы.

Преимущества DFD-диаграммы:
1.Прослеживание потока данных в системе
2.Выделение ключевых процессов и взаимодействий
3.Увеличение понимания системы
4.Легкость коммуникации и обсуждения с заказчиком
5.Основа для проектирования и разработки системы

Краткое описание и основные принципы

В IDEF0, разновидности DFD-диаграммы, используется специализированная нотация для более детального отображения потоков и работающих объектов внутри системы. Основные принципы создания DFD-диаграммы в IDEF0 следующие:

  1. Определение системы: Определите систему, которую необходимо проанализировать и моделировать с помощью DFD-диаграммы. Определите основные элементы системы, такие как входные и выходные данные, процессы, соответствующие источники и приемники данных.
  2. Определение процессов: Идентифицируйте основные процессы, которые выполняются в системе для обработки данных. Каждый процесс должен быть четко определен и иметь конкретную функцию или задачу.
  3. Определение потоков данных: Определите потоки данных, которые перемещаются из одного процесса в другой или между процессами и внешними источниками/приемниками данных. Каждый поток данных должен иметь четко определенное имя и описание.
  4. Определение работающих объектов: Определите работающие объекты, которые обрабатываются в системе. Работающие объекты могут быть группированы по типу или функции.
  5. Ориентация потоков данных: Определите направление потоков данных на диаграмме. Потоки данных могут быть однонаправленными или двунаправленными в зависимости от взаимодействий между процессами и работающими объектами.
  6. Декомпозиция процессов: Разбейте сложные процессы на более мелкие подпроцессы для более подробного моделирования. Каждый подпроцесс должен быть описан и иметь связь с основным процессом.

Создание DFD-диаграммы из IDEF0 требует внимательного анализа системы и ее компонентов, чтобы точно отобразить потоки данных и процессы. Правильное использование и понимание нотации IDEF0 поможет создать информативную и наглядную диаграмму для лучшего понимания системы.

Метод IDEF0

Метод IDEF0 позволяет создать структуру функций, процессов и взаимодействий, которые существуют в системе. Он основывается на иерархическом подходе к моделированию, где основные функции системы разбиваются на множество более мелких подфункций.

Для создания IDEF0-диаграммы необходимо провести следующие шаги:

  1. Определить функцию системы. Функция — это действие или процесс, который система выполняет для достижения цели.
  2. Разбить функцию на более мелкие подфункции. Это помогает уточнить и детализировать каждый шаг процесса.
  3. Определить взаимодействия между функциями. Это помогает понять порядок и последовательность выполнения задач.
  4. Создать диаграмму, отражающую иерархическую структуру функций и их взаимодействия.

Метод IDEF0 является мощным инструментом для анализа системы и улучшения ее производительности. Он помогает проектировщикам, инженерам и управляющим получить полное представление о функциональных аспектах системы и определить потенциальные проблемы и улучшения.

Обзор метода и его применение

IFEFD0 разделен на несколько уровней детализации, которые отражают разные аспекты работы системы. На каждом уровне создается диаграмма, на которой отображаются функции и их взаимосвязи.

Основное применение метода IDEF0 заключается в анализе и оптимизации бизнес-процессов. С его помощью можно выявить неэффективные операции, избыточные ресурсы или недостатки в организации работы системы.

Другим применением IDEF0 является разработка новых систем. Метод позволяет спроектировать функции и их взаимосвязи с учетом требований и целей проекта. Это помогает создать систему, которая наиболее эффективно будет выполнять необходимые функции и соответствовать требованиям пользователей.

Метод IDEF0 также находит применение при анализе и оптимизации информационных систем. Он позволяет выявить ошибки и улучшить процессы обработки и передачи информации в системе.

В целом, метод IDEF0 является мощным инструментом для анализа, проектирования и оптимизации различных систем. Он позволяет визуализировать функции и их взаимосвязи, а также выявлять ошибки и недостатки в работе системы. Использование IDEF0 упрощает процесс создания DFD-диаграмм и повышает их эффективность.

Создание DFD-диаграммы

Для создания DFD-диаграммы следуйте следующим шагам:

  1. Определите цель и область диаграммы. Прежде чем начать создавать DFD-диаграмму, определите, что именно вы хотите отобразить и какие компоненты системы вам необходимы.
  2. Определите процессы и их взаимодействие. Определите основные процессы в системе и их взаимосвязь. Используйте символы для обозначения входных и выходных данных, процессов и хранилищ данных.
  3. Задайте потоки данных. Определите, какие данные передаются между различными процессами и хранилищами данных. Используйте символы для обозначения потоков данных.
  4. Постройте диаграмму. Начертите диаграмму, используя символы для обозначения процессов, данных и потоков. Создайте связи между компонентами и укажите направление потоков данных.
  5. Анализируйте и оптимизируйте диаграмму. После создания диаграммы проведите анализ ее структуры, выявите возможные проблемы и сделайте необходимые изменения для оптимизации процессов.

Создание DFD-диаграммы может занять некоторое время и требует внимания к деталям. Однако, эта диаграмма может оказаться очень полезной в процессе разработки системы, позволяя более точно понять взаимодействие компонентов и определить узкие места и потенциальные проблемы.

Подготовка к созданию диаграммы и основные шаги

1. Определение целей и потоков

Перед началом работы над DFD-диаграммой необходимо определить основные цели и потоки информации, которые нужно учесть. Цель диаграммы может быть направлена на анализ процесса или на создание новой системы. Также важно определить, какие именно данные будут изображены на диаграмме и как они будут обрабатываться.

2. Выделение функций и объектов

На этом этапе нужно выделить основные функции и объекты, которые будут присутствовать на диаграмме. Функции представляют собой действия или операции, выполняемые над данными, а объекты — конкретные элементы, которые участвуют в процессе обработки информации.

3. Определение взаимодействий

На этом этапе нужно определить взаимодействия между функциями и объектами. Например, функция может получать данные от объекта или передавать данные другой функции. Важно учесть все возможные потоки данных и их направления, чтобы создать полную и точную диаграмму.

4. Создание диаграммы

После проведения предыдущих этапов можно приступить к созданию самой диаграммы. Для этого можно использовать специальные программы или инструменты для создания диаграмм, например, Microsoft Visio или draw.io. На диаграмме необходимо изобразить все функции и объекты, а также связи между ними. Важно также подписать каждый элемент диаграммы, чтобы было понятно, что именно он обозначает.

5. Проверка и корректировка

После создания диаграммы нужно провести ее проверку на полноту и правильность. Важно убедиться, что все взаимодействия и потоки данных правильно отображены на диаграмме и отражают действительность. При необходимости можно вносить корректировки и исправления, чтобы диаграмма стала более понятной и точной.

6. Документирование и использование

После завершения работы над диаграммой можно приступить к ее документированию и использованию. Документация может включать описание каждой функции и объекта, а также их взаимодействия. Диаграмма может быть использована для анализа или оптимизации процесса, а также для разработки новой системы или программного обеспечения.

Примеры использования IDEF0

Примеры использования IDEF0 включают:

  1. Разработка и оптимизация бизнес-процессов. IDEF0 позволяет визуализировать функции и их взаимосвязи в рамках бизнес-процесса, что помогает выделить улучшения и оптимизировать работу организации.
  2. Анализ систем и моделирование. IDEF0 позволяет описать структуру и функции системы, что помогает улучшить понимание ее работы и выявить возможные слабые места или улучшения.
  3. Управление проектами. IDEF0 может быть использован для разработки модели проекта, включающей этапы, ресурсы и взаимосвязи функций в рамках проекта. Это позволяет более эффективно планировать и контролировать ход проекта.
  4. Управление качеством. IDEF0 позволяет описать требования и функции, связанные с процессом контроля качества, что помогает улучшить понимание и эффективность контроля.
  5. Анализ и проектирование бизнес-систем. IDEF0 позволяет разработать модель функциональных взаимосвязей системы, что помогает анализировать ее текущее состояние и проектировать улучшения.

Это лишь некоторые примеры использования IDEF0. Он находит применение в различных сферах и может быть полезен для анализа и моделирования различных процессов и систем.

Конкретные примеры применения метода

Метод IDEF0 (Integrated DEFinition for Function Modeling) широко применяется для моделирования и анализа функциональных процессов в различных областях. Ниже приведены некоторые конкретные примеры применения данного метода:

1. Моделирование бизнес-процессов:

IDEF0 может быть использован для моделирования бизнес-процессов организации. Например, можно построить IDEF0-диаграмму организации доставки еды, чтобы понять, какие функции выполняются, какие ресурсы используются и какие связи существуют между различными процессами.

2. Анализ системных функций:

IDEF0 также может быть применен для анализа функций системы. Например, при разработке программного обеспечения можно использовать IDEF0 для определения функциональных требований и составления блок-схемы всех функций, выполняемых программой.

3. Оптимизация производственных процессов:

В производственной области IDEF0 может быть использован для анализа и оптимизации процессов производства. Например, можно построить IDEF0-диаграмму процесса сборки автомобиля, чтобы выявить возможности улучшения процесса, устранения избыточных операций и улучшения использования ресурсов.

Пример применения методаОбласть применения
Моделирование бизнес-процессов организации доставки едыБизнес
Анализ функций программного обеспеченияИнформационные технологии
Оптимизация производственных процессов в автомобильной промышленностиПроизводство

Таким образом, метод IDEF0 может быть применен в различных областях для анализа и моделирования функциональных процессов, что позволяет улучшить эффективность работы организации и оптимизировать использование ресурсов.

Оцените статью
Добавить комментарий